Elk Range Royalties is an active buyer of mineral and royalty interests in the US. We have partnered with NGP Energy, an investment firm with over 30-year history of investing in the oil and gas business. This provides us with strong financial backing in the form of patient capital with a long-term horizon. Since our inception in 2020, Elk Range has invested over $1.2B in capital and is currently investing out of its third equity commitment from NGP under Elk Range Royalties III.

Elk Range Royalties is seeking an experienced Controller. The successful applicant will be an integral part of the Accounting Team and will report directly to the VP of Finance and Accounting as well as work closely with the Accounting Manager and various internal teams. The role will be located in Dallas, Texas and is required to be in-person.
· Oversee all aspects of financial reporting for all Elk Range entities including quarterly and annual financial statements in accordance with GAAP and industry standards
· Oversee the preparation and submission of required quarterly reports to NGP and the banks
· Manage the annual audits and work with tax advisors to facilitate the K-1 process
· Manage outsourced accounting resources to ensure timeliness and accuracy of general accounting and other critical workflows
· Conduct detailed review and analysis of financial performance of acquisitions to ensure appropriate asset management (in pay with operators timely and accurately)
· Collaborate with internal teams (finance, land, engineering, and development) to complete and enhance current workflows – e.g., accruals, LOS preparation, and variance analysis.
· Be a leader of the accounting function and prioritize development of the team
· Assist the VP of Finance & Accounting with liquidity management
· Manage the settlement process with acquisition and divestiture counterparties
